We could >>>> maybe pass it in the kernel cmdline to the watchdog driver >>>> for user space? >>>> >>> >>> Not truth for N900. Bootreason depends on PRM_RSTST omap >>> register, state of vbat charger pins, time how long was power key >>> pressed, R&D data stored in CAL partition and other undocumented >>> registers for omap HS devices. I already tried to implement at >>> least some subset of it in userspace (or kernel), but it is >>> impossible because NOLO bootloader clear status of PRM_RSTST >>> register. >>> >>> There is also copy of PRM_RSTST register stored at address >>> 0x4020FFB8 (tracing data) but that address is rewritten (probably >>> by kernel), so we really cannot implement reading bootreason in >>> kernel. >>> >>> But in early stage in uboot it is possible to read 0x4020FFB8 >>> address and get some part of bootreason. But still PRM_RSTST is >>> not enough! >>> >>> I would be happy if DT kernel can export /proc/atags file with >>> ATAGs passed by bootloader. It would be enough for me.
